Re: [aspectj-users] Another Noobie Question

There is an undocumented AJ feature, borrowed from AW, that can do
that: hasMethod/hasField.

I really think it is time it is integrated into AJ, since questions
like these regularly pop up in this list and it was implemented in AW
and worked fine (no one ever complained about its design there).
Besides that, it is one of the main reasons that projects that use AW
cannot migrate to AJ (genesis included).

On 9/15/06, Peter Murray <pete@xxxxxxxxxxxx> wrote:

I'd like to be able to add a marker interface to all classes having members
which are annotated @Transactional.  Is there a way to specify a complex
match like that?

declare parents: <classes with members which @Transactional> implements
TransactionalMarker

Any thoughts?
